The cheapest way to get from Philadelphia to Mount Pocono is to drive which costs $17 - $25 and takes 2h 8m.
The fastest way to get from Philadelphia to Mount Pocono is to drive which takes 2h 8m and costs $17 - $25.
Yes, there is a direct bus departing from Philadelphia and arriving at Mount Pocono. Services depart once daily, and operate every day. The journey takes approximately 4h 50m.
The distance between Philadelphia and Mount Pocono is 116 miles. The road distance is 95.2 miles.
The best way to get from Philadelphia to Mount Pocono without a car is to bus which takes 4h 50m and costs $25 - $45.
The bus from Philadelphia to Mount Pocono takes 4h 50m including transfers and departs once daily.
Philadelphia to Mount Pocono bus services, operated by Greyhound USA, depart from Philadelphia station.
Philadelphia to Mount Pocono bus services, operated by Greyhound USA, arrive at Mount Pocono station.
Yes, the driving distance between Philadelphia to Mount Pocono is 95 miles. It takes approximately 2h 8m to drive from Philadelphia to Mount Pocono.
